Compartir a través de


Configurar la validación de campos cruzados

Este tema describe cómo habilitar la validación de campos cruzados o segmentos en elementos de datos del conjunto de transacciones en mensajes con codificación EDI Para ello, necesita definir dos valores:

  • Defina la marca de validación de campos cruzados en una anotación del esquema EDI. En el caso de los esquemas X12 o HIPAA, esta es la marca de X12ConditionDesignator_Check . En el caso de los esquemas EDIFACT, esta es la marca de EdifactDependencyRule_Check .

  • Habilite la validación de tipo EDI en las propiedades del acuerdo.

Requisitos previos

Debe haber iniciado sesión como miembro del grupo de administradores de BizTalk Server.

Configurar la validación de campos cruzados

  1. Abra el esquema en el Editor de BizTalk.

  2. Para un esquema X12 o HIPAA, busque la marca X12ConditionDesignator_Check en una anotación en la sección appinfo del esquema. Establézcalo en .

    Nota

    Establecer la marca X12ConditionDesignator_Check en no se puede realizar desde el Editor de esquemas de BizTalk. pero puede abrirla en un bloc de notas o en un editor de texto similar, editarla y guardar el archivo de esquema (.xsd).

  3. Para un esquema EDIFACT, busque la marca EdifactDependencyRule_Check en la anotación de la sección appinfo del esquema. Establézcalo en .

  4. Para los segmentos que correspondan del esquema, especifique las condiciones de relación (X12 e HIPAA) o las reglas de dependencia (EDIFACT) que sean de aplicación. Para obtener más información, consulte Validación cruzada de Field-Segment.

    Nota

    Se especifica una regla o condición de validación de campos cruzados para un segmento del esquema EDI. Si especifica una regla de validación de campos cruzados para un elemento de datos en lugar de un segmento, BizTalk Server generará una advertencia cuando se lleve a cabo la validación del esquema.

  5. En la página Validación (en la sección Configuración del conjunto de transacciones ) de la pestaña contrato unidireccional del cuadro de diálogo Propiedades del contrato correspondiente, asegúrese de que la propiedad Validación de tipo EDI está seleccionada.

Consulte también

Desarrollo de esquemas EDI